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Basic Metal Finishing - Most frequently, the polishing of metal is important for aesthetic reasons and for clean-room usages. It is one of the most popular procedures simply because of its utility in boosting the natural beauty of the item, for instance, motor bike parts, car parts or kitchenware. Besides that, a good number of clean-rooms will require a sleek finish so as to lessen the penetrability of the material which may result in debris to collect and contaminate. An illustration of this implementation could be in vacuum chambers. You will find a variety of strategies to polish metals, and we will consider a few of the techniques involved. Various metals may be burnished chemically, electromechanically, with special buffing machines, or by hand. A buffing compound or paste is frequently utilized, which could contain aluminum oxide, limestone, chromium oxide, tripoli, chalk, dolomite, or iron oxide. Buffing stainless steel, due to its inferior th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its relatively high viscosity is among the most time intensive. However, goods constructed from non-ferrous metals tend to be more amenable to buffing, as they need the lowest amount of treatments.
When a greater processing quality will not be essential, swifter pad speeds can be utilised. A reduced pad speed is commonly used if a high standard mirror finish is necessary. Finishing buffs smeared with paste can be greatly affected by the pressures on the pad. The strength of the pressure on the surface may be raised to a precise range, though surpassing the perfect amount of load not simply lowers the quality level of the procedure, but also worsens performance, could result in wear on the product, and there is moreover a noticeable heating of the pieces being worked on, thanks to friction. When you are working on thin objects, it's greater temperature (and the relating flexibility of the metal) that will sometimes cause parts to warp, buckle or distort. In general, it will require an experienced polisher to take into account all these points to both avert harm to the workpiece and to give good results proficiently. To appreciably improve the quality of the resulting surface, the buffing action must be completed with a reduced amount of aggression and not a large amount of force so as to after a while deliver a surface area that is free of scores or fine lines caused by the polishing process, therefore arriving at a beautiful mirror finish.
